About Carlos Hurtado

Carlos Hurtado is a scholar working on Aquatic Science, Global and Planetary Change and Nature and Landscape Conservation, having authored 38 papers that have together received 334 indexed citations. Recurring topics across this work include Marine Bivalve and Aquaculture Studies (16 papers), Marine and fisheries research (11 papers) and Aquaculture Nutrition and Growth (6 papers). The work is most often cited by research in Aquatic Science (65 citations), Water Science and Technology (76 citations) and Global and Planetary Change (115 citations). Carlos Hurtado has collaborated with scholars based in Chile, Spain and Portugal. Frequent co-authors include Beatriz Cancino, Dante Queirolo, René Ruby‐Figueroa, Milagrosa C. Soriguer, Karim Erzini, Eduardo Quiroga, Yulong Duan, Xin Yan, Alfonso Gutiérrez and Gabriele Lara. Their work appears in journals such as SHILAP Revista de lepidopterología, Marine Pollution Bulletin and Aquaculture.
